CVE-2017-12608
A vulnerability in Apache OpenOffice Writer DOC file parser before 4.1.4, and specifically in ImportOldFormatStyles, allows attackers to craft malicious documents that cause denial of service memory corruption and application crash potentially resulting in arbitrary code execution...
CVE-2017-9806
A vulnerability in the OpenOffice Writer DOC file parser before 4.1.4, and specifically in the WW8Fonts Constructor, allows attackers to craft malicious documents that cause denial of service memory corruption and application crash potentially resulting in arbitrary code execution...
CVE-2017-12607
A vulnerability in OpenOffice's PPT file parser before 4.1.4, and specifically in PPTStyleSheet, allows attackers to craft malicious documents that cause denial of service memory corruption and application crash potentially resulting in arbitrary code execution...
Apache OpenOffice Update Patches Four Vulnerabilities
The Apache Software Foundation fixed four vulnerabilities Friday tied to its popular Apache OpenOffice suite of free productivity applications. The patches are for the suite’s word processing and graphics apps. Each of the vulnerabilities are rated medium in severity. Three of the four bugs patch...

Apache OpenOffice DOC WW8Fonts Constructor Code Execution Vulnerability
Summary An exploitable out of bound write vulnerability exists in the WW8Fonts::WW8Fonts functionality of Apache OpenOffice 4.1.3. A specially crafted doc file can cause an out of bound write potentially resulting in arbitrary code execution. An attacker can send/provide a malicious doc file to...

CVE-2017-3157
By exploiting the way Apache OpenOffice before 4.1.4 renders embedded objects, an attacker could craft a document that allows reading in a file from the user's filesystem. Information could be retrieved by the attacker by, e.g., using hidden sections to store the information, tricking the user in...
